Total Cost of Ownership — Electric vs Petrol Scooter
When comparing an electric scooter to a petrol scooter, the total cost of ownership (TCO) is a critical factor. While the upfront cost might seem comparable, the long-term economics diverge significantly.
- Initial Purchase Price: Electric scooters often have a competitive initial cost, especially when considering available incentives. Petrol scooters generally have a similar upfront price point.
- Daily Running Cost: Electric scooters offer a meaningfully lower per-kilometre cost, primarily due to cheaper electricity compared to petrol prices. Petrol scooter running costs fluctuate directly with fuel prices.
- Maintenance Expenses: Electric scooters typically require fewer scheduled service visits and have a simpler drivetrain, leading to lower routine maintenance costs. Petrol scooters typically require routine engine maintenance, including oil changes and filter replacements.
- Residual Value: Both types of scooters maintain a residual value, but the long-term ownership economics often favour electric over typical multi-year horizons due to lower operational expenses.

Maintenance & Service Burden
The maintenance requirements for electric and petrol scooters present a stark contrast. A petrol scooter's engine is a complex mechanical system requiring regular oil changes, spark plug replacements, air filter cleaning, and periodic tune-ups to ensure optimal performance. This translates to more frequent service visits and associated costs. An electric scooter, with its simpler drivetrain consisting mainly of a motor, controller, and battery, inherently has fewer moving parts. This design leads to fewer scheduled service visits and a significantly reduced maintenance burden.
